Three Huntingdon wrestlers place in Cumberland Open

LEBANON, Tenn.  – Three Huntingdon wrestlers placed and nine Hawks combined to win 14 matches in the Cumberland Open on Sunday.

Quintez Pearson placed second in the 149-pound division, Andrew Smith placed fourth in the 125-pound division and Joseph Pearson placed fourth in the 285-pound division.

Quintez Pearson won his first three matches before losing in the 149-pound championship match. The senior won each of his first three matches by decision, advancing to the championship match with a 3-2 win. Pearson lost 3-1 in the final match.

Smith was 2-2 in the 125-pound division, earning a win by major decision in the quarterfinals before losing by decision in the semifinals. In the consolation bracket, Smith advanced to the third-place match with a win by decision before closing the day with a loss by decision.

Joseph Pearson was 2-2 in the 285-pound division. After losing his first match by pin, he won back-to-back consolation matches (pin and decision) before losing the third-place match by pin.

Kaleb Fontenot also won two matches for the Hawks. Fontenot was 2-2 and advanced to the 157-pound semifinals with a win by major decision and a win by decision. Fontenot lost by decision in the main bracket semifinals and lost by technical fall in the consolation semifinals.

Tristan Powell (133), Shade Lacombe (157), Jayson Spencer (165), Mac Hirsh (184) and Jack Haury (197) each won one match.

 

Coming Up: Huntingdon returns to action on Feb. 9 in the Newberry Open in South Carolina.
